KISS Have Rescheduled The Perth Date Of Their Upcoming Australian Tour

UPDATE 14/11/19KISS Have Cancelled Their Farewell Australian Tour

KISS are headed to Australia this month as part of their farewell ‘End of the World’ tour, and were planning to kick off the run of dates in Perth on Saturday, 16th November at RAC Arena.

Now, as Triple M reports, the band have been forced to reschedule the opening date of the tour, after singer and guitarist Paul Stanley came down with a bad case of influenza, with doctors advising Stanley to rest for the next few days rather than undertake the extensive flight from Los Angeles to Perth.

As such, the show has been moved from Saturday, 16th November to Tuesday, 3rd December, still taking place at RAC Arena. All tickets for the original show are valid and no exchange is necessary.

Punters who are unable to make the new date are able to receive a refund from Monday, 25th November, and are able to request that via this form.

The tour will now kick off in at Coopers Stadium in Adelaide on Tuesday, 19th November. Check out a statement from promoters TEG Live and see amended tour dates below.
